
Dimapur, July 12 (MExN): The Chakro Angami Kuda Union has expressed discontentment over the allegations made by the Advocate General of Nagaland K N Balgopal against Advocate Edward Belho, who is the Standing Counsel for Nagaland in the Supreme Court of India.
In a letter addressed to the Chief Minister of Nagaland appended by CAKU President K Medom and CAKU Jt. Secretary Keneiselie Angami stated: “...shocked to learn about the conduct of Mr K N Balgopal in campaigning for removal of Mr Edward Belho from the post he is now holding, by virtue of his sheer competence, by levelling false allegations and passing misinformation against him at the corridors of power.” The note also stated that the matter has been deliberated upon by the leaders of the Tenyimia community of Dimapur in a meeting on July 10, wherein it was resolved to the “open letter” to the Chief Minister of Nagaland.
The CAKU in the note stated that Edward Belho is a young and promising lawyer and is well known for his honesty, efficiency and amiable personality and has so far enjoyed full confidence of the State Government. It has appealed the Chief Minister of Nagaland “not to entertain or consider the unjustified demand” put forth by K N Balgopal for the removal of Edward Belho from the post of the Standing Counsel for Nagaland in the Supreme Court of India.
